There was only an interesting problem during the new installation. The rescue
boots on my Atari TT but the system hangs short after atabootstrap wrote:
booting Linux
A few hours later I found out that the battery of the hardware clock was empty.
Only exchange it changed nothing. I had to search for an atari language disk
and set the time and date with the cpx... Now it works.
